Bankroll Management: Your Roadmap to Success
Every pilot monitors their fuel. My bankroll is my fuel, and I handle it with strict rules. Before I play, I establish a loss limit I won’t exceed and a win target at which I’ll withdraw. I split my total session bankroll into smaller blocks, and I never wager more than a fixed slice, say one or two percent, on a single spin. This system stops me from making emotional, desperate bets after a loss. It means I can endure a rough patch and stay in the game long enough to hit the bonus rounds and profitable phases. Without a strategy, you can crash long before you see any real success.
Understanding and Tailoring to Game Volatility
Pilot game has its own behavior pattern, which we term volatility https://aviacasino.games/pilot/. I made the effort to determine if it was low, medium, or high. A high-volatility game rewards less frequently but the wins are more substantial, so you should have a larger budget and a lot of endurance. A low-volatility game provides regular, smaller wins, great for lengthier gaming periods. I modify my strategy to match. For high volatility, I place smaller bets and anticipate quiet periods, waiting for the major payoff. For lower volatility, I could consider a more progressive betting style. Knowing this characteristic helps you establish practical goals and pick the right tactics.
